What is Business Administration?

Business administration is the systematic study of how businesses function, from small-scale operations to global corporations. It involves various aspects like managing operations, marketing products or services, handling finances, and overseeing staff.

This field also looks into strategic planning, ensuring a company's long-term success and growth. Additionally, it touches on entrepreneurship, the art of starting and growing new businesses.
